About Jollys Lookout

One of Brisbane's most famous picnic spots, Jollys Lookout in D'Aguilar National Park, is known for its stunning panoramic views over Enoggera Forest Reserve out toward the city, further up to the Glasshouse Mountains and Moreton Bay. Set among the backdrop of the lush, dense rainforest and eucalypt forest of Mount Nebo, Jollys Lookout is a sweeping opening featuring barbecues, sheltered and exposed picnic tables, and a well-maintained toilet block that has a baby change room. The lookout is wheelchair accessible and offers a wonderful way to enjoy a lazy afternoon picnic with family, friends or a loved one.
